Have you ever wondered how Stoicism can help you become a more confident public speaker? In today’s digital age, where communication often happens through screens and social media, mastering mindful communication is more essential than ever. Stoicism teaches you to stay present and aware of your thoughts and emotions, allowing you to communicate with clarity and purpose. When you approach your audience—whether live or virtual—with mindfulness, you avoid reacting impulsively or getting caught up in negative self-talk. Instead, you focus on delivering your message intentionally, which not only improves your clarity but also helps you connect more authentically with your listeners.

Practicing mindful communication enhances clarity, authenticity, and connection in digital public speaking.

Building emotional resilience is another core aspect of Stoic philosophy that directly benefits public speaking. When you face criticism, technical difficulties, or unexpected questions during your presentation, it’s natural to feel anxious or overwhelmed. But Stoicism encourages you to view these challenges as opportunities to grow rather than threats. By cultivating emotional resilience, you learn to maintain your composure, adapt to setbacks, and stay focused on your purpose. This mindset allows you to navigate the unpredictable nature of speaking engagements with calm confidence, reducing performance anxiety and boosting your overall effectiveness.

In a digital world, where feedback can be instant and often harsh, Stoicism guides you to detach your self-worth from external validation. Instead of obsessing over likes, comments, or perceived judgments, you focus on what you can control—your effort, preparation, and delivery. This shift in perspective helps you develop a resilient mindset, so you’re less likely to be thrown off course by online criticism or technical mishaps. As a result, you become more consistent and authentic in your communication, fostering trust and credibility with your audience.

Furthermore, by practicing mindful communication, you become more attuned to your audience’s reactions and needs. This awareness enables you to adjust your tone and message in real-time, making your speeches more engaging and impactful. It also helps you listen carefully to questions or feedback, demonstrating respect and attentiveness. When you combine mindful communication with emotional resilience, you can handle digital distractions—like notifications or interruptions—with grace, ensuring that your message remains clear and compelling. Ultimately, Stoicism empowers you to approach public speaking with a calm, centered mindset. It teaches you to focus on what truly matters—your message and your connection with your audience—rather than external noise or internal doubts. By developing mindful communication and emotional resilience, you turn challenges into opportunities for growth, making you a more confident and effective speaker in any digital setting.

What Are Practical Tips for Maintaining Composure in Virtual Presentations?

You can stay composed during virtual presentations by embracing the irony that your calmness depends on simple practices. Practice mindful breathing to anchor yourself, especially when nerves spike. Maintain good posture awareness to project confidence and stay grounded. Take pauses to reset if you feel overwhelmed. Remember, your calmness isn’t about perfection but about consciously choosing to stay present—so breathe, sit straight, and let your confidence shine through.
